Fairfax High School students Kendal Straub, Trenton Kingery, and Braden Graves, with the help of Garrett Vernon, Dr. Burright, and Mr. Nichols, painted railroad ties and had big white rocks delivered. They then created a giant F on the hillside along Hwy. 59 in Fairfax in front of Fairfax High School.
Members of the Fairfax Student Council also helped with the project. They include: Bryon Ohlenselen, Lataveon Brown, Cowen O’Riley, Ty Kirkland, Mason Kingery, Amelia Larson, and Chloe Vernon.
